NAFDAC Denies Suspending Sachet Alcohol Enforcement: What's the Truth? (2026)

A recent statement from the National Agency for Food and Drug Administration and Control (NAFDAC) has sparked a conversation about the regulation of sachet alcohol and its impact on public health. The agency, led by Prof. Mojisola Adeyeye, has categorically denied reports suggesting a directive to halt enforcement actions against sachet alcohol products.

In a bold move, NAFDAC has clarified that it has not received any official communication from the Federal Government regarding a suspension of its regulatory activities. The agency emphasizes its commitment to operating within its statutory mandate, aligning with government policies, and upholding existing laws and regulations.

"The said publication is false and misleading," NAFDAC stated, referring to the reports. They further stressed the importance of accurate information, warning against the spread of unverified news, which can lead to public anxiety and economic instability.
